‘The History of Kabbalah and Zohar’
Rabbi David Sedley and
TorahLab have translated the introduction to Shomer Emunim HaKadmon. Written by Rabbi Yaakov Irgas in the late 17th century, Shomer Emunim HaKadmon is a basic introduction to kabbalah.
This introduction, taken from the text of the book itself and updated to the late 20th century, was written by Rabbi Yitzchak Stern of Jerusalem in 1965. It provides an invaluable guide to the transmission and development of kabbalah from the time of Avraham Avinu and Rabbi Shimon bar Yochai through the Gaonim and Rishonim to the modern era.
Perfect for Lag BaOmer, the hilula of Rabbi Shimon bar Yochai.
